    I spent a few hours trying to make the upgrade work

    • disabled all apps
    • even in recovery mode I could not access the web terminal
    • enabled debug to True, but nothing came up
    • even with all apps disabled by renaming the apps/ folder, it would not boot core nextcloud beyond the /healtcheck point

    I had to restore to 4.15.0 to have it back online

    • Nextcloud 25.0.1

    96903cee-19e2-4812-ae14-a861df899200-image.png

    context Cloudron v7.3.4 (Ubuntu 22.04.1 LTS)

    The more I dig about this the more I think it may be unrelated to Nextcloud?

    I have right now, NocoDB, N8N and Metabase apps in "not responding" mode after the their respective last package upgrade.

    this for one cloudron v7.3.4 (Ubuntu 22.04.1 LTS)
    Nocodb log are strange, crash just after the app start and nginx config done 510c6e47-900d-4929-9d3c-0308bbcbf4e2-image.png

    it's like the logging stop but still display the last "running" log when the app was online? the timing match the time it has been down and the two package upgrade that occured.

    N8N logs also stopped the 29 0ad11019-b5de-4a98-a431-1376655f5f22-image.png this is just when the app started its upgrade, then rebooted and stopped logging ??

    Same for Metabase :

    5d9d2ec6-e0b1-44c3-873e-0a0aa357c121-image.png
    I can restart the app or go in recovery mode and see the log working for these steps, but the moment the apps should actually boot, logs stop and that's it c37a6d23-3194-4e26-b3dd-d1b2d2e07b4e-image.png

    But curiously, 2 N8N instance on v7.3.5 (Ubuntu 22.04.1 LTS) do not seem to be suffering the same issue.

    These apps in "not responding" mode seem to be crashing without any log beyond the restarting progress in the terminal, nothing happens after that.
